Covid-19 cases in Inverclyde has now been contained according to health bosses.Jeane Freeman confirmed there have been no new cases linked to the Port Glasgow spike since Saturday and it has "reached the end of the transmission chain".The outbreak was linked to the M&D pharmacy in the town, as well as other businesses and a worker at Amazon's warehouse in Gourock.Stuart McMillan, the MSP for Greenock and Inverclyde, asked the Health Secretary about the cluster during ministerial questions in the Scottish Parliament on Tuesday.Freeman said: "I'm very pleased to say that in terms of the Port Glasgow cluster, that members will recall involved a local pharmacy and a local business, there have been no further cases with respect to that cluster.
